Deputy Director-General, Water Resources Agency, MOEA
Chien-Cheng Chen
Mr. Chen, Chief Engineer of the Water Resources Department, has over 25 years of experience in hydraulic engineering. He has held various key positions in the Water Resources Bureau, including Director of Sixth River Management Branch, Deputy Chief Engineer, and Chief Secretary.
In 2025, he assumed the position of Deputy Director-General, where he is responsible for advancing water resource and flood control projects, operational management of water facilities, reservoir modernization and safety assessments, as well as water source scheduling and domestic water supply. He has been involved in projects such as the construction of the Niaozueitan Artificial Lake , river management and disaster preparedness and response.
